Speed skater Sáblíková faces 3000 m at Olympics, skiers start with downhill

Speed skater Martina Sáblíková will compete in the 3000 metres on Friday at her sixth Olympic Games. She won gold over the distance in Vancouver and silver in Sochi, but after finishing fourth four years ago, she is not among the main favourites in Milan. Her best results this season were two sixth places in Salt Lake City and Inzell, while the top contenders include World Cup leader Ragne Wiklund of Norway and Dutch world champion Joy Beune. Alpine skiing also gets under way, with the men’s downhill in Bormio the highlight of the day.
